Output fd8cb8bdb5cbfe8d000d2410bc7496a91c76c653bdce6a0586fbff648ec65bd1:7

value
900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c666c2ed98fe7fcd8ce9f4c743123b06abc80e8e OP_EQUAL
address
3Kn4pWtGpA81qE5rUVLUcEStBpEfVwM6vd
transaction
fd8cb8bdb5cbfe8d000d2410bc7496a91c76c653bdce6a0586fbff648ec65bd1
confirmations
43514
spent
true